Chapter 1225: Looking for a Fight

After hearing this, Zhang Shan paused slightly and couldn’t help but blurt out five words—

“Capture the king before his troops.”

After hearing this, Chu Tianqiu nodded slightly. “So that means your target is also Heavenly-Dragon or Qinglong? Looks like we’re on the same path.”

“But I always feel this mission is a bit too difficult.”

Zhang Shan lowered his head and clenched his fists, feeling this was an extremely rare situation. Even after finishing the fight, “Heavenly Movement” was still active.

Even when he fought in “Eddy City” before, “Heavenly Movement” couldn’t have lasted this long.

If even his type of “Echo” could last this long, once other people obtained their “Echoes,” they should also never dissipate.

This was both because the “Barrier” in the sky had disappeared and possibly because the giant bell and display screen had been destroyed.

In the past, the people here had relied too heavily on the prompts from the display screen and giant bell.

When obtaining an “Echo,” the bell would ring; when losing an “Echo,” the bell would also ring.

This convenient and easy-to-understand method allowed everyone to stabilize their “Echoes,” but it also greatly restricted the upper limit of their “Echoes.”

For something as difficult to fathom as “Echoes,” if one constantly thought “the Echo will disappear when the bell rings,” that represented wavering will, and the bell would inevitably ring.

Now the giant bell and display screen were both gone. No one would hear the sound “announcing the Echo’s dissipation,” so they simply didn’t know when their “Echo” would disappear.

Zhang Shan briefly explained the train of thought he had come up with to Chu Tianqiu.

After all, if his own dull brain could already think this far, then Chu Tianqiu could naturally think even further.

“You’re saying there’s always been a ‘Barrier’ here…?”

If there was any important figure who died today because of someone’s “scheme”—

It should only be Earth-Dragon, the referee of the “Cangjie Chess” game.

When he first saw her, Chu Tianqiu had faintly sensed a special aura about her. Thinking about it now, that should have been the obsession of “wholeheartedly rushing to death.”

From the moment Earth-Dragon appeared, she was prepared to die.

So she was the one who released the “Barrier.”

At the moment she fell into a life-or-death gamble with the “Participants,” she immediately chose suicide, and using suicide as the wager, she exchanged Chu Tianqiu’s entire team’s lives from Qinglong.

This death that caught Qinglong off guard had, in Chu Tianqiu’s view, extremely high tactical value. It almost single-handedly changed the entire battle situation.

So the signal for “rebellion” didn’t start with destroying the giant bell and display screen at all, but rather started with Earth-Dragon’s death.

“Removing the ‘Barrier’ can increase the intensity of ‘Echoes,’ and destroying the giant bell can extend the duration of ‘Echoes.'” Chu Tianqiu murmured. “These two actions seem completely unrelated, but in reality, they comprehensively strengthen the remaining ‘Participants.'”

“But both actions are double-edged swords, right?” Zhang Shan said. “Removing the ‘Barrier’ can not only strengthen ‘Echoes’ but might also make people more insane. Although destroying the giant bell can make ‘Echoes’ difficult to dissipate, it will also make it very difficult for people with unsteady wills to obtain ‘Echoes.'”

“There are almost no people with ‘unsteady wills’ now.” Chu Tianqiu said. “Anyone who can board this ‘train’ is no ordinary person.”

After hearing this, Zhang Shan paused, then looked at Chu Tianqiu and Qin Dingdong with a puzzled expression.

“What’s wrong?” Chu Tianqiu asked.

“Something’s strange…” Zhang Shan scratched his head. “Everything we’re talking about concerns ‘affecting Participants,’ but you two… are completely unaffected?”

“These two changes might affect most people, but there are exceptions to special cases.” Chu Tianqiu turned his head to give Qin Dingdong a meaningful look, then said indifferently, “That is, people who have preserved their memories long enough. Such people won’t feel confused by more memories and already have sufficiently powerful ‘Echoes.'”

“It can work like that…” Zhang Shan nodded with half understanding.

After hearing this, Chu Tianqiu chuckled lightly and turned back to look at Qin Dingdong. “The impressive people I know all preserve their memories using different methods. What method do you use?”

“Big sister won’t tell you.” Qin Dingdong said with pursed lips. “You all just know how to ask, ask, ask. Am I holding some kind of press conference here?”

After hearing this, Chu Tianqiu shrugged and could only stop asking Qin Dingdong. He turned to Zhang Shan again. “Zhang Shan, you said you want to ‘capture the king before his troops’—is that all the tactics you have?”

“Pretty much.” Zhang Shan nodded. “I’m planning to have a fight with them.”

“One-on-one with Heavenly-Dragon or Qinglong? This plan sounds too reckless—doesn’t seem like something Qi Xia would come up with.” Chu Tianqiu thought for a moment. “You at least need a helper who’s about the same level.”

“Hey! Big guy!” Broken Mandarin rang out from the distance. Two figures were walking toward them from far down the corridor.

Chu Tianqiu looked at those two people. “Now that’s more like it.”

Zhang Shan turned his head and saw Qian Wu and Qiao Jiajin approaching.

“Tianqiu boy!” Qiao Jiajin walked up and enthusiastically greeted everyone. “Wow, there’s also the big mouse and Dingdong-jie.”

If not for the fact that “Zodiacs” were standing all around them, they would have almost thought they’d run into acquaintances at a night market.

“Damn…” Zhang Shan looked Qiao Jiajin up and down. “You made it up here too, kid?”

“Yeah.” Qiao Jiajin nodded. “Hey big guy, are you busy later? Interested in coming with me to beat someone up?”

“I’m busy.” Zhang Shan answered. “I’m planning to go to the ‘front of the train’ to look for a fight.”

“What a coincidence!” Qiao Jiajin laughed. “I’m also planning to go to the ‘front of the train’ to look for a fight…”

After saying this, Qiao Jiajin froze and hurriedly asked, “Oh shit, the person you’re looking for isn’t me, is it?”

“Damn, are you sick in the head?” Zhang Shan was confused by Qiao Jiajin’s line of thinking and asked with a frown. “I came all the way to the front of this ‘train’ to fight you? Am I crazy or are you crazy?”

“Oh, haha.” Qiao Jiajin gave a dry laugh. “As long as it’s not me, that’s good. I was afraid you were holding a grudge.”

“Holding a grudge…?”

“Ah, never mind, never mind.” Qiao Jiajin waved his hand and walked forward to put his arm around Zhang Shan’s shoulders. “Now it’s good. As soon as I heard the person to fight wasn’t you, I felt much more relaxed hahaha. Fighting you again would really kill me from exhaustion.”

“You kid are acting all mysterious…” Zhang Shan scratched his head and said, “So what, is it just the two of us going?”

“There’s also the pervert guy.” Qiao Jiajin stuck out his thumb and gestured toward Qian Wu. “The three of us will go together.”

“I’m not going.” Qian Wu interrupted from the side. “Also, don’t call me pervert guy.”

“Huh?” Qiao Jiajin looked at him. “You’re not going? Didn’t the liar boy say before…”

“I’m not going. My task is to use ‘Twin Flowers’ to transform both your bodies entirely into ‘Heavenly Movement.'”

“Huh?”
